where is the oil pressure switch located ?


Quote:
Originally Posted by Dave928
there's a very good chance it is your Oil Pressure Switch. it was on mine.

it's a metal housing with a plastic insert and the metal contact runs thru that. the plastic gets hard and the oil slips out past the contact. this has been a notoriously faulty part on VW/Audi/Porsches for decades...
